| Problem | Likely Cause | Solution | |---------|--------------|----------| | TV ignores USB and boots normally | File name incorrect | Rename file exactly as required (case-sensitive). | | “No update file found” | Wrong file system | Reformat USB to FAT32. | | Update starts but stops at 99% | Corrupt firmware or bad USB sector | Re-download firmware and try a different USB drive. | | TV turns black and stays black after update | Power supply or incompatible firmware | Unplug for 1 hour; try recovery with older firmware version. | | Remote unresponsive during update | Normal | Do not use remote until update is fully complete. |
